McNee Ranch State Park, located in Half Moon Bay, California, is part of the California State Parks system, dedicated to preserving the state's extraordinary biological diversity and cultural resources. The park offers a variety of outdoor recreational opportunities, ensuring that visitors can enjoy the natural beauty and unique landscapes of the region.

In addition to providing access to scenic trails and open spaces, McNee Ranch State Park emphasizes inclusivity and sustainability, addressing challenges such as climate change and enhancing educational programs in collaboration with local communities. The park also features resources for planning adventures, including reservation systems and mobile applications to facilitate visitor engagement with nature.
